Georges Aloe Vera, 128 fl oz (3.785 lt) 3785 ml
Georges Aloe Vera, 128 fl oz (3.785 lt) 3785 ml
$26.45
Due to the density of the order, it can be shipped within 2 - 5 days.
100% PureFractionally Distilled Liquid from Aloe Vera Leaves.
100% PureFractionally Distilled Liquid from Aloe Vera Leaves.